Abstract
562,343. Oil engines. PESCARA, R. P. Feb. 5, 1943, No. 1967. Convention date, April 30, 1942. [Class 7 (iii)] A fuel injection system comprises an injector 6 delivering directly into the cylinder and an injector 7 directed into an ante-chamber to the cylinder, the direct injection starting before the antechamber injection. As shown, a single cam actuates both injectors and the passage of fuel to the ante-chamber injector 7 is delayed by inserting a tortuous path 12 into the supply line 9, but if two or more pairs of injectors are used, the ante-chamber injectors may be operated by a separate cam and the interval between the direct and ante-chamber injections be made variable, for example, in correspondence with the charging pressure. The charge delivered by the ante-chamber injector is smaller than that of the direct injector and may be kept constant, the direct charge being increased as the'load increases.
